Location: Ellicott City, MD
Type: Full-Time
Hours: 8:30am - 5:30pm (Monday-Friday)
Department: Safety & Health Training
Reports to: Training Manager
Job Summary:
The Training Center Coordinator is responsible for managing and coordinating all training programs and activities within the Safety & Health Training Center. This role ensures the smooth operation of the training center, coordinates training schedules, and provides administrative support to trainers and participants for programs including CPR training, healthcare professional training, safety training, and OSHA compliance training. Additionally, the Training Center Coordinator will be a certified instructor, capable of teaching as a backup when needed.
Key Responsibilities:
- Training Program Coordination:
- Develop and manage training schedules for CPR, healthcare professional training, safety, and OSHA compliance training.
- Coordinate with trainers to ensure all necessary materials, equipment, and certifications are prepared and available.
- Monitor and evaluate the effectiveness of training programs, collecting feedback, and suggesting improvements.
Teaching and Instruction:
- Serve as a certified instructor, capable of teaching various safety and health courses including CPR and OSHA training.
- Act as a backup instructor when primary trainers are unavailable, ensuring continuity of training programs.
Administrative Support:
- Maintain accurate records of training activities, including attendance, assessments, and certifications.
- Handle participant registration, enrollment, and follow-up communications.
- Prepare training rooms, including setting up audiovisual equipment and arranging seating.
Resource Management:
- Ensure the training center is stocked with necessary materials, supplies, and equipment.
- Manage the training center budget, tracking expenses and reporting on financials.
- Coordinate with external vendors and service providers as needed.
Customer Service:
- Act as the first point of contact for training inquiries, providing excellent customer service to both internal and external clients.
- Address and resolve any issues or concerns related to training activities.
Compliance and Reporting:
- Ensure all training activities comply with relevant policies, regulations, and OSHA standards.
- Prepare and submit regular reports on training activities and outcomes to senior management.
Qualifications:
- Education:
- Bachelor's degree in Occupational Safety, Health Education, Human Resources, Business Administration, or a related field.
Experience:
- Minimum of 2-3 years of experience in training coordination or a related administrative role.
- Experience in a safety and health training environment is highly desirable.
Skills:
- Strong organizational and multitasking abilities.
- Excellent communication and interpersonal skills.
- Proficiency in Microsoft Office Suite and familiarity with Learning Management Systems (LMS).
- Knowledge of OSHA regulations and safety training protocols.
- Ability to work independently and as part of a team.
Certifications:
- Must be a certified instructor in relevant safety and health areas, such as CPR and OSHA compliance.
Additional Information:
Work Environment:
- This role typically operates in a professional office setting within a training center.
- Occasional travel may be required for training events or professional development.
- Benefits:
- Competitive salary and benefits package.
- Opportunities for professional development and career advancement.
